Post kala-azar dermal leishmaniasis in East Africa, with a focus on Sudan: Review of three decades of experience and research
Post kala-azar dermal leishmaniasis (PKDL) is a well-known complication of visceral leishmaniasis (VL, kala-azar) in East Africa, with most cases reported from Sudan; the first description of PKDL dates back to 1921.
